A student earned a grade of 80% on a math test that had 20 problems. How many problems on this test did the student answer corre
boyakko [2]

Answer:

16 problems.

Step-by-step explanation:

100% divided by 20 questions.

100/20 is equal to 5, therefore each question is worth 5 points.

Grade of 80% divided by points per question.

80/5 is 16 so the student answered 16 questions correctly.
